Atomic Backland Pro SL
Best lightweight touring boot for efficient backcountry climbs.
A high-performance touring boot that prioritizes weight savings and climbing efficiency. It offers an exceptional range of motion for long days on the skintrack without sacrificing the durability needed for the descent.

Performance breakdown
Uphill Efficiency
The 74-degree cuff rotation makes long ascents feel remarkably natural.
Weight Optimization
Minimalist construction keeps fatigue at bay during high-mileage backcountry tours.
Traction Performance
Skywalk rubber soles provide reliable grip on icy, mixed-terrain scrambles.
Shell Durability
Polyamide construction balances lightweight agility with necessary long-term resilience.
Hygiene Maintenance
Washable liners make it easy to keep boots fresh after sweaty efforts.
Transition Speed
Streamlined design allows for rapid switching between climbing and skiing modes.
